There is conflicting evidence as to whether oral lichen planus (OLP) can undergo malignant transformation into squ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C). This study aimed address this issue by analyzing a sample of Brazilian patients with either OLP or OSCC. Patients and Methods. was conducted in São Paulo, the world's fourth-largest city population. AbstractThis article reports a case in which patient, an adult black male, was diagnosed as having sialadenosis of idiopathic type, since clinical, computed tomography and laboratory examinations did not disclose any other abnormalities that could be associated with the glandular swelling. As this condition is quite harmless, requiring no intervention, unless for aesthetic reason, patient dismissed, being monitored sporadically.
